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Roberts

** The Toyota repair market serving Roberts, Wisconsin, is characterized by high-quality independent shops rather than dealerships located within the village itself. The closest Toyota dealerships are in the Twin Cities metro area (e.g., St. Paul), which leads local residents to rely on the reputable independent shops in Hudson and River Falls. **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ally very high. The shops in this region compete on reputation and technical skill, leading to a market where expertise, transparency, and customer retention are paramount. **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ate but healthy. There are several established shops, but they are not oversaturated. This environment benefits the consumer, as shops must maintain high standards to remain competitive, but wait times for popular, reputable shops can be several days during peak seasons.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ates in this region are typically in the **$110 - $140 per hour** range, which is competitive for the Upper Midwest and generally lower than dealership rates in the nearby metropolitan area. Pricing is considered fair for the level of expertise offered, and these shops are often more cost-effective than dealerships for major repairs like engine, transmission, and hybrid system work.

What are the most common Toyota repairs needed by drivers in the Roberts, Wisconsin area?

Due to our cold winters and road salt, common repairs for Roberts Toyota owners include brake system corrosion, exhaust issues, and undercarriage rust prevention. Additionally, local driving on rural and county highways can lead to earlier wear on suspension components like struts and control arms on models like the RAV4 and Highlander.

When should I seek service for my Toyota's check engine light around Roberts?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e issue that could damage the catalytic converter, especially during long commutes on I-94.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ly at a local shop to prevent a minor issue from worsening in our variable climate.

Are Toyota repair costs in Roberts typically higher than for other brands?

Toyota repairs are generally very competitive due to the brand's reliability and widespread parts availability. Labor rates in Roberts are often lower than in larger metro areas, but costs for specific repairs can vary between local independent garages and the nearest dealerships.

What local seasonal service should Roberts Toyota owners prioritize?

Prioritize a thorough brake inspection and fluid check before winter, and a cooling system service before summer. Given Wisconsin's temperature extremes, ensuring your Toyota's battery is tested each fall is crucial, as cold snaps can quickly reveal a weak battery.
